Hello all.
Z690 Phantom Gaming 4 13700KF 16+16 DDR4 3600 I bought M2 NVME: ADATA S70 1TB SSD AGAMMIXS70-1T-C This drive worked for 10 minutes (I only managed to install the OS) after which it disappeared from the system and is not detected in the BIOS. After a cold start of the computer, the SSD appears, but cannot fully load the OS and again it disappears from the system. Im check all 3 m2 ports. Same. If I remove this SSD and use SATA3 2.5 SSD, everything works fine and without errors. The most interesting thing is that I have an old processor: i5-12400 I installed it for testing. With this processor (12400) this SSD works fine (in M2_1 slot), the OS boots and passes all tests. Please help. |
